Properties of different emission peak YAG∶Ce~(3+) powders

Ding Jian-hong, LI Xu-bo, Haiyong Ni, Chaohui Huang, Zhang Zhen

Open publisher page 2 citations

Abstract

YAG∶Ce~(3+) powders with different emission peak were prepared by high temperature solid method.Samples were checked by X-ray diffraction and F-4500 spectrophotometer.The results showed excitation spectra didn't change with Gd~(3+) concentration and emission peak shift to red wavelength with the concentration of Gd~(3+) ion increasing.Also,emission intensity increased with increasing Ce~(3+) concentration and the highest emission intensity was observed at 0.06 mol Ce~(3+) concentration.Emission spectra and excitation spectra didn't shift with Ce~(3+) concentration.
